>Ultimately, though, I found plaintext to be the easiest
>way to maintain a digital zettelkasten across Windows, Mac, and iOS,
>especially now that ConnectedText seems to no longer be under active
>development.
>

This is a question we all struggle with.  I keep asking myself what ‘easiest’ means in this context.  Does it literally mean the minimum time it takes to manage your info (overhead)?  I’m leaning towards using the best software available until it’s no longer viable, then doing a ‘hard migration’ when you need to switch platforms.  Which could very well mean copying every single item individually and re-coding the links and metadata.  I figure if the difference between the ‘best fit’ software and plain text is a 20% gain in productivity/usefulness then that’s worth several days of hard migration every couple years.  I also justify more CRIMPing by telling myself that ‘hard migration’ is basically a huge review of all your stuff which has a large theoretical value.

If I were to go to a plain text system, I’d take a hard look at tagspaces.  Their front-end to a plain text note collection has intrigued me for a while.
